His Majesty's Young Offender Institution (or HMYOI) is a type of prison in Great Britain, intended for offenders aged up to 18, although some prisons cater for younger offenders from ages 15 to 17, who are classed as juvenile offenders. Typically those aged under 15 will be held in a Secure Children's Home and those over 15 will be held in either a Young Offender Institution or Secure Training Centre. Fewer than 2% of young Victorians aged 10-17 are alleged by police to have committed a crime. Fewer than 1% get a sentence in the Children’s Court.
